Southwest Dip

Staci at Random Sweets
Pepperoni and green chilies give this warm appetizer just enough kick to be irresistible. The pecans on top give it just the right crunch.

Equipment

  • small pie pan

Ingredients
  

  • 8 oz cream cheese, softened
  • ½ cup sour cream
  • 3 oz pepperoni, diced
  • 4 oz chopped green chilies, undrained
  • Tbsp chopped onion
  • 2 tsp chopped chives, optional
  • ½ cup chopped pecans

Instructions
 

  • Heat oven to 350℉. In a bowl, mix everything except pecans. Spread in a small baking dish or pie pan. Sprinkle top with pecans.
  • Bake at 350℉ for 20 minutes. Serve warm with tortilla chips and crackers. Makes approximately 3 cups.
